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
152875924 582164 16589591 105874 852
5406 980561878
5406 980561878
2590533 74873 64024 9499
All about undefined
Interested in learning more?
5406 980561878
2590533 74873 64024 9499
See more
0121 10813622165
5030 546320 01502060
See more
62742978 29270044 637
3416867891 923320 901982590
See more